Malacca is a village in the Nicobar district of Andaman and Nicobar Islands, India. It is located in the Nancowry tehsil.[1]
Demographics
According to the 2011 census of India, Malacca has 35 households. The effective literacy rate (i.e. the literacy rate of population excluding children aged 6 and below) is 88.46%.[2]
| Total | Male | Female |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 158 | 76 | 82 | 
| Children aged below 6 years | 28 | 8 | 20 | 
| Scheduled caste | 0 | 0 | 0 | 
| Scheduled tribe | 155 | 75 | 80 | 
| Literates | 115 | 64 | 51 | 
| Workers (all) | 40 | 28 | 12 | 
| Main workers (total) | 15 | 12 | 3 | 
| Main workers: Cultivators | 0 | 0 | 0 | 
| Main workers: Agricultural labourers | 0 | 0 | 0 | 
| Main workers: Household industry workers | 0 | 0 | 0 | 
| Main workers: Other | 15 | 12 | 3 | 
| Marginal workers (total) | 25 | 16 | 9 | 
| Marginal workers: Cultivators | 0 | 0 | 0 | 
| Marginal workers: Agricultural labourers | 0 | 0 | 0 | 
| Marginal workers: Household industry workers | 0 | 0 | 0 | 
| Marginal workers: Others | 25 | 16 | 9 | 
| Non-workers | 118 | 48 | 70 |
